When did this issue start? Did it happen after a specific event such as a Windows update or hardware change? In some cases, Bluetooth might be hidden in Device Manager. Try the following:
Open Device Manager (search for it in the Start menu).
Click the "View" menu and select "Show hidden devices."
Look for "Bluetooth" or similar entries. If you find them, right-click and enable them.
Even though Device Manager doesn't show Bluetooth, you can still try updating the drivers manually.
Visit your computer manufacturer's website.
Download the latest Bluetooth drivers compatible with your operating system.
Run the downloaded installer and follow the on-screen instructions to update the drivers.
